The drive cycles have to complete over time. Start-stop. Freeway. WOT. Cruse. Braking. All of it. It is probably different for different mfrs.
The short-term long-term fuel curves also have to be set.
Yes, it is different. My favorite step is to drive 60 for six minutes and then pull your foot off the gas and coast down to 20 mph without touching the brakes.

I can go 60 mph on I77 for six minutes but have to find an uphill grade and put the car on the shoulder to slow down to not end up as a grease spot.
